WebJulia Child was born Julia Carolyn McWilliams, on August 15, 1912 in Pasadena, California. Julia was known by several pet names as a little girl, including "Juke", "Juju" and "Jukies." WebIn 2002, Child was the inspiration for "The Julie/Julia Project", a popular cooking blog by Julie Powell that was the basis of Powell's bestselling book, Julie and Julia: 365 Days, 524 Recipes, 1 Tiny Apartment Kitchen, published in 2005, the year following Child's death.
